Hey everyone, I recently found a wrapped roll of unc 1964 whistling Queen Nickels and am struggling to figure out where I can sell them most effectively. I reached out to colonial acres but it's apperantly not a recognized variation, although coinsandcanada pulled data for one sold at $95 MS64. I've listed on ebay, not much action for a few days, same with Facebook marketplace and a Canadian coins forum also on Facebook. Has anyone has good luck with any specific auction company in Ontario? Not much demand, realistically worth about $10 uncertified.
You'll net only a couple of bucks at auction.
Keep trying on ebay, anything can happen there.
